Council previews rezoning of 1425 Kingston to allow roughly 10 single-family lots

Ogden City Council · February 4, 2026
AI-Generated Content: All content on this page was generated by AI to highlight key points from the meeting. For complete details and context, we recommend watching the full video. so we can fix them.

Summary

Staff presented a rezoning proposal to rezone multiple former-church parcels at 1425 Kingston to R-1-8, enabling about 10 single-family lots; planning staff and the petitioner said lots match surrounding development, the planning commission recommended approval 6–0, and petitioner Gary Cannon said homes would likely target owner-occupiers but development-agreement owner-occupancy is not proposed.

Planning staff presented a rezoning request for 1425 Kingston at the council's Feb. 3 work session that would consolidate several parcels now split between R-1-10 and R-1-8 into a single R-1-8 zoning designation to allow a small single-family subdivision.
